All i want is a fish that swims around the tank that i dont have to look for to grab the attention so far :

1 orange firegoby spends all his time in a little cave he's made under a piece of live rock.

1 lawnmower blenny who spends his time at the back of tank behind the pieces of liverock.

1 keyhole Angelfish who has found a nice spot of pretty constant algae growth behind my biggest piece of live rock so stays behind that all day grazing.

so my only on view fish are two clownfish which at 1.5 in each dont grab much attention in a 4 foot tank.
 
look for some Cardinals (bangaii or pajama).. buy 3-5 of them and they will school out in the open areas of your tank..

also..

pick up a couple clowns (buy them as a pair).. they're always fun to watch and I've had two sets, neither were particularly scared off when people came up close to the tank.(oh, I see you have them already)..

also... pick up some firefish goby's.. they also school and they'll stay primarily out in the open..


all of the above listed fish are colorful/fun to watch..
